We’re here to tell you that chickpeas are more than just a bean dip.

Known for their starring role in the Mediterranean masterpiece, hummus, chickpeas have found their way into our hearts and our pantries. But did you know that this round, nutty legume makes a tasty ingredient in everything from salads to soups to pasta dishes?

It’s no wonder a 2021 food trend report names chickpeas “the new cauliflower.” These loveable legumes are as versatile as they are healthy. Chickpeas—also known as garbanzo beans—are loaded with heart-healthy fiber and contain a number of antioxidants, vitamins and minerals too. In addition, their high protein content makes them a valuable alternative for those that follow vegetarian and vegan diets.
